What is the Arizona Donor Prequalification Form?
The Arizona Donor Prequalification Form is designed for individuals considering whole body donation to Research For Life. Its primary purpose is to collect vital health information that assists in determining eligibility for donation. Completing this form is a significant step in the donor registration process, ensuring that the necessary medical history is documented and verified before acceptance.

Field-by-Field Instructions for the Arizona Donor Prequalification Form
Each section of the Arizona Donor Prequalification Form requires specific information:
-
Current health status, including any ongoing treatments.
-
Weight and height, as these are critical for determining eligibility.
-
Detailed medical history, including past surgeries and diagnoses.
To avoid common mistakes, ensure that all fields are accurately filled and double-check for consistency across all entries.

What are the eligibility requirements for filling out this form?
To be eligible, you must be an adult considering whole body donation, providing accurate health information, and your next of kin must also consent if required.
How long does it take to process the Arizona Donor Prequalification Form?
You can expect notification of acceptance within 3-4 weeks after submitting your completed form along with the necessary documents.
How can I submit the completed form?
After filling out the form, including all required signatures, submit it together with the Donor Registration Packet as specified in the instructions.
What supporting documents are required when submitting this form?
While the main requirement is the completed Prequalification Form, check if any additional documentation is specified in the Donor Registration Packet provided by Research For Life.
What common mistakes should I avoid when completing this form?
Ensure all personal health information is accurately filled out and signed where required; also, avoid leaving any mandatory fields blank.
Is notarization required for this form?
No, notarization is not required for the Arizona Donor Prequalification Form.
What happens if I submit an incomplete form?
Submitting an incomplete form may delay the processing of your application, so review all fields carefully to ensure completeness before submission.
